Declyn Griffin produced his most outstanding game to date while leading Poplar Springs to the win on Thursday. Bethlehem had no answer to Griffin as he scored four runs and stole four bases while getting on base in five of his six plate appearances. Griffin has been consistent recently: he hasn't given up a single hit in three consecutive pitching appearances.
Griffin and Poplar Springs will head out on the road to square off against Laurel Hill at 5:00 p.m. on Tuesday. The last time Griffin duked it out with Laurel Hill (back in April of 2023), Poplar Springs came out on top by a score of 11-1. Will another strong game from Griffin be enough to do it again?
